I have been breeding zebs for a couple of years. I have just had a fawn female & a CFW male produce a clutch of 3 chicks, which appeared to be penguin colourations, and all of which had white beaks. Unfortunately they all died within a day of fledging, possibly because they were ejected too young so the parents could renest. I can't find any info on the white beaks and whether this is a genetic flaw. Can anyone help?
